The Role of Coolant in the Engine

Coolant, also known as antifreeze, is a liquid solution that is designed to absorb heat from the engine and transfer it to the radiator, where it can be dissipated. The coolant system is responsible for maintaining a consistent engine temperature, which is essential for optimal performance, fuel efficiency, and engine longevity.

There are two main types of coolants: ethylene glycol (EG) and propylene glycol (PG). EG is the most commonly used coolant and is effective in temperatures as low as -20°C (-4°F). However, it can be toxic and corrosive if ingested or spilled. PG, on the other hand, is a safer and more environmentally friendly alternative, but it is less effective in extremely cold temperatures.

The Role of Coolant in Your Range Rover

Coolant, also known as antifreeze, is a liquid that circulates through your engine to absorb and dissipate heat. Its primary function is to prevent the engine from overheating, which can cause damage to the engine block, cylinder head, and other critical components. The coolant also helps to prevent corrosion and rust by protecting metal surfaces from coming into contact with water.

There are two main types of coolants: ethylene glycol and propylene glycol. Ethylene glycol is the most common type of coolant and is widely used in modern vehicles. It has a lower freezing point than propylene glycol, making it more effective in cold temperatures. However, it can be toxic to humans and pets if ingested, and it can also contaminate soil and water if not disposed of properly.

    Frequently Asked Questions

    What is the Best Coolant for Range Rover?

    The best coolant for Range Rover depends on various factors, including the model year, engine type, and personal preferences. Generally, a 50/50 mix of antifreeze and water is recommended for most Range Rover models. However, some models may require a specific coolant type, such as Longlife Coolant (LLC) or Extended Life Coolant (ELC). It’s essential to consult your owner’s manual or speak with a Range Rover dealership or certified mechanic to determine the recommended coolant for your vehicle.

    How Does Coolant Work in Range Rover?

    Coolant plays a crucial role in maintaining the optimal operating temperature of your Range Rover’s engine. It absorbs heat from the engine and transfers it to the radiator, where it’s dissipated. The coolant also prevents corrosion and freezing in the cooling system. When the coolant is mixed with water, it creates a mixture that protects the engine from overheating and freezing temperatures. The recommended coolant ratio for Range Rover is typically 50% antifreeze and 50% water, but this may vary depending on the specific model and engine type.

    How Often Should I Change the Coolant in My Range Rover?

    The frequency of coolant changes depends on various factors, including the type of coolant used, driving conditions, and age of the vehicle. Typically, it’s recommended to change the coolant every 30,000 to 50,000 miles, or as specified in the owner’s manual. However, if you drive in extreme temperatures, tow a trailer, or engage in frequent stop-and-go traffic, you may need to change the coolant more frequently. Consult your owner’s manual or speak with a certified mechanic to determine the recommended maintenance schedule for your Range Rover.

    Can I Mix Different Coolant Types in My Range Rover?

    While it’s technically possible to mix different coolant types in your Range Rover, it’s not recommended. Mixing different coolants can lead to incompatibility issues, corrosion, and damage to the cooling system components. It’s essential to use the recommended coolant type and mix ratio for your Range Rover to ensure optimal performance and protection against corrosion and overheating. Consult your owner’s manual or speak with a certified mechanic to determine the best coolant for your vehicle and provide guidance on the proper installation and maintenance procedures.
